Optically Clear Adhesives for Lens Bonding
Camera lenses, microscope lenses and lenses and prisms in optical devices such as lasers are often bonded with special adhesives, or cement, and fixed in their housing. In order not to impair the quality of the optical system, these special adhesives must not only have a high optical purity, they must also have low shrinkage in order to avoid stresses in the lens systems. The latter is often achieved by adding special fillers in the nanoscale size range.
Furthermore, prism or lens systems consisting of several lenses or prisms can also be joined together using adhesives or optical cement. These adhesives are used, for example, in cameras and optical sensors or for joining rod lenses in endoscopes. These adhesives must be highly transparent and have a specific refractive index.
As the optical components have to be fixed quickly after high-precision adjustment, very fast-curing UV adhesives are usually used here. Hoenle offers special adhesives for lens bonding for both glass and plastic lenses.
